Description
A constant terror occurs at the University in a mysterious way because of the many murders that occur. The story began when Michelle was killed by a person hiding in a student car called Natalie. Natalie noted these controversial processes, a strange pattern of continuous homicide in the university, especially when her boyfriend is choked in the room to death. It turns the university into a constant terror among students because of an unknown mysterious killer. In the end, Natalie was able to find the killer and stop the bloodshed at the university, which looked like a real massacre.
